> > > While code reading and giving signedness scrutiny in print-domain.c I
> > > noticed there being opportunity for variables to underflow into the
> > > negative and
> > > thus being positive in testing. Here is a code-snippet of function
> > > ns_print():
> > >
> > > 572 void
> > > 573 ns_print(const u_char *bp, u_int length, int is_mdns)
> > > 574 {
> > > 575 const HEADER *np;
> > > 576 int qdcount, ancount, nscount, arcount;
> > > 577 const u_char *cp;
> > > 578 u_int16_t b2;
> > > 579
> > > 580 np = (const HEADER *)bp;
> > > 581 TCHECK(*np);
> > > 582 /* get the byte-order right */
> > > 583 qdcount = EXTRACT_16BITS(&np->qdcount);
> > > 584 ancount = EXTRACT_16BITS(&np->ancount);
> > > 585 nscount = EXTRACT_16BITS(&np->nscount);
> > > 586 arcount = EXTRACT_16BITS(&np->arcount);
> > >
> > > notice qdcount,ancount,nscount and arcount can wrap into the negative and
> > > that is being tested like so:
> > >
> > > 603 while (qdcount--) {
> > >
> > > But really what's meant is qdcount-- > 0 as there is no negatives in
> > > here. I
> > > personally don't feel comfortable having tcpdump go deeper into this and
> > > print-domain.c is complex(!!) I can only guess that with this it's
> > > possible
> > > to print domain names that don't exist with this. I just don't feel all
> > > that
> > > comfortable with this, it gives me a bad feeling.

> > While not pretty there is nothing wrong with the current code.
> >
> > All 4 variables qdcount, ancount, nscount, arcount are only decremented by
> > one and always checked for 0. So there is no way any of the 4 values
> > become negative. Also the EXTRACT_16BITS() puts a uint16_t into an int
> > which never overflows on OpenBSD. int is always 32bit on OpenBSD.
> >
> > Still it may make sense to apply the diff just to be explicit about the
> > count values.

> I ask you to look closer. Perhaps I didn't explain the problem best.
> Let's take variable qdcount:
>
> 603 while (qdcount--) {
>
> After this while() qdcount wraps, and that's fine if it isn't reused! But in
> the same function below it is tested again (at which point it is negative).
>
> 686 if (qdcount--) {
>
> and
>
> 690 while (cp < snapend && qdcount--) {
>
>
You also need to have a closer look.
Line 603 is in
if (DNS_QR(np)) {
Line 686 is in the corresponding else block. So there is no way to get
from 603 into 686 and 690.
